M. Bennis et al., EVIDENCE FOR COEXISTENCE OF CCK-8 AND GNRH IN NEURONS OF THE MESENCEPHALIC TEGMENTUM IN THE CHAMELEON, Neuroscience letters, 240(3), 1998, pp. 155-158
A double-label immunofluorescence technique was used to demonstrate th
e co-localization of cholecystokinin-8 (CCK-8) and gonadotrophin-relea
sing hormone (GnRH) in individual neurons and processes of the chamele
on brain. Go-localization was limited to a small population of cells i
n the dorsomedial tegmentum; in other regions of the brain, neurons we
re observed to be either CCK-8-immunopositive or GnRH-immunopositive b
ut never both. However, double-labeled fibers and terminals were found
to be distributed at a low density throughout the thalamus, the media
l hypothalamus, the tegmentum and the spinal cord. These data provide
the first indication for the co-localization of CCK-8 and GnRH, whose
functional significance remains to be established. (C) 1998 Elsevier S
cience Ireland Ltd.
